Yii2 예외 잡는 방법
yii 모든 예외는 Exception에서 상속됩니다. 예외를 캡처하는 방법에는 두 가지가 있습니다.
//a文件: function a() { throw new \yii\web\HttpException('我是数据库异常'); } //b文件: use yii\db\Exception;
한 가지 작성:
try{ a(); } catch(\yii\web\HttpException $e) { echo "捕获到异常了"; }
두 가지 작성:
try{ a(); } catch(\Exception $e) { echo "捕获到异常了"; }
권장 관련 기사 튜토리얼: yii 튜토리얼
위 내용은 yii2 예외를 잡는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!